/**
* @flow
*/
import type { NavigationScreenProp } from 'react-navigation';
import * as React from 'react';
import { Button, ScrollView, StatusBar } from 'react-native';
import { StackNavigator, SafeAreaView } from 'react-navigation';
type NavScreenProps = {
navigation: NavigationScreenProp<*>,
};
class HomeScreen extends React.Component<NavScreenProps> {
static navigationOptions = {
title: 'Welcome',
};
render() {
const { navigation } = this.props;
return (
<SafeAreaView>
<Button
onPress={() => navigation.push('Other')}
title="Push another screen"
/>
<Button onPress={() => navigation.pop()} title="Pop" />
<Button onPress={() => navigation.goBack(null)} title="Go back" />
<StatusBar barStyle="default" />
</SafeAreaView>
);
}
}
class OtherScreen extends React.Component<NavScreenProps> {
static navigationOptions = {
title: 'Your title here',
};
render() {
const { navigation } = this.props;
return (
<SafeAreaView>
<Button
onPress={() => navigation.push('Other')}
title="Push another screen"
/>
<Button onPress={() => navigation.pop()} title="Pop" />
<Button onPress={() => navigation.goBack(null)} title="Go back" />
<StatusBar barStyle="default" />
</SafeAreaView>
);
}
}
const StackWithHeaderPreset = StackNavigator(
{
Home: HomeScreen,
Other: OtherScreen,
},
{
headerTransitionPreset: 'uikit',
}
);
export default StackWithHeaderPreset;
